If the Thumblight thumbnail generation queue's service account is locked out (usually after three failed token refreshes), do not recreate the account; that orphans all in-flight render jobs. Instead, open the Penwick recovery console, select the queue tenant, and choose "restore credential." The console will pause consumers automatically — wait for the amber banner before proceeding, and verify the dead-letter count is stable. When prompted by the console, enter the recovery passphrase exactly as it appears below.

vault phrase of bafop-kahop = sormir-frador

## Authentication

RestockPilot talks to the Vendora inventory service over HTTPS. All requests must include a bearer token in the Authorization header; unauthenticated calls return 401 immediately. Tokens are issued per environment, so don't reuse your staging token against production. Rate limits are generous but enforced per key. For local development against the staging cluster, use the shared contractor key below.

service key, tadup-tahog: zpat7_wB1tnEL

The Pinefare points ledger is the source of truth for every member's balance. Support agents can view entries but never edit them directly — all corrections go through the adjustment tool, which writes a signed compensating entry. If a customer reports a missing accrual, check the pending queue first; accruals can take up to two hours to post after a purchase. Manual adjustments above 5,000 points require lead approval. The adjustment workflow, approval rules, and common ledger states are documented on the internal page.

wiki page, yawig-haweg: https://confluence.lumicsys.internal/pages/pages/projects/pages

## Changelog — Font vendoring defaults changed

As of this release, the Bracken UI build no longer fetches third-party fonts at build time. All typefaces used by the Lanternwell suite are now vendored into the repo under a dedicated assets directory, and the fetch step is skipped by default. If you're onboarding, nothing to install — the fonts travel with the checkout. The build flags controlling this behavior are listed below.

settings of hadup-yafog:
LAMAEL_PIN=3761
LAMAEL_TENANT=istmir
LAMAEL_METRICS_HOST=metrics.lamael.plorvasys.test
LAMAEL_SEAL=seal_8ea68500
LAMAEL_STANDBY_TEAM=fraok